Bushehr vs Fort Reliance, Nt Climate & Distance Between

Canada flag
  • The distance between Bushehr, Iran and Fort Reliance, Nt, Canada is approximately 11,022 km or 6,849 mi.
  • To reach Bushehr in this distance one would set out from Fort Reliance, Nt bearing 14.5°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Bushehr bearing 169.6° or S .
  • Bushehr has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Fort Reliance, Nt has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
  • The annual mean temperature is 31.2 °C (56.2°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 24.3 °C (43.7°F) less in Bushehr.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to truly continental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 44.3 mm (1.7 in) less which is equivalent to 44.3 l/m² (1.09 US gal/ft²) or 443,000 l/ha (47,360 US gal/ac) less. About 5/6 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 21.6° higher in Bushehr than in Fort Reliance, Nt.
